GLOBE CEO CARL CRUZ CHAMPIONS AI‑ENABLED CUSTOMER INNOVATION AND ORGANIZATIONAL TRANSFORMATION AT MWC 2026
Globe President and CEO Carl Cruz underscored the company’s AI‑driven transformation and commitment to digital inclusion during his interview on the WinWin Live platform at Mobile World Congress (MWC) 2026.
Cruz highlighted Globe’s pioneering move as the first Philippine operator to appoint a Chief AI Officer, signaling that AI is a strategic capability embedded across the organization. He emphasized Globe’s adoption of the GSMA Responsible AI Maturity Roadmap and the creation of an AI Innovation Hub, ensuring innovation is pursued responsibly and sustainably.
“We appointed the country’s first Chief AI Officer to ensure AI is guided by ethics, security, and purpose. Today, our teams have built AI tools solving real pain points across the business. For me, the measure is simple, if AI helps us serve customers better and widen access to opportunity, then we are using it with purpose, uplifting more Filipino lives and building a #GlobeOfGood,” Cruz said.
Cruz noted that Globe is redefining customer centricity in the digital‑first era by investing in AI‑driven innovations such as personalized care, self‑service platforms, and proactive network monitoring. These solutions empower subscribers to manage accounts seamlessly, anticipate issues before they disrupt lives, and enjoy hyper‑personalized experiences that place convenience and control directly in their hands.
Addressing challenges in scaling AI, Cruz pointed to Globe’s focus on empowering employees through its AI Advocates Guild, embedding ethical safeguards, and modernizing operations with cloud‑native infrastructure. Early results include multimillion‑peso savings from the GenAI Quality Audit, over 400 employee‑built AI bots, and global recognition with three Open Innovation Catalyst Awards at DTW Ignite 2025.
Looking ahead, Cruz outlined Globe’s vision to achieve Stage 5 AI maturity, where autonomous agents not only drive new business models but also advance sustainability by reducing CO₂ emissions through predictive intelligence. “Our mission is to uplift the life of every Filipino, while keeping our customers, our nation, and the environment at the heart of our priorities. Just as the internet transformed society, AI will be equally disruptive, and Globe is committed to harnessing it responsibly as a tool for progress, building a more inclusive, sustainable, and empowered digital future,” he affirmed.
